The Journal of General Physiology, Vol 61, 146-157, Copyright © 1973 by The Rockefeller University Press


ARTICLE

Dog Red Blood Cells

Adjustment of density in vivo



John C. Parker 1

1 From the Division of Hematology, Department of Medicine, University of North Carolina School of Medicine, Chapel Hill, North Carolina 27514

Red blood cells from mature dogs contain less Na and more K than would be the case if they were in Donnan equilibrium with plasma. They have no ouabain-sensitive Na pump, and their membranes are deficient in Na, K-ATPase. Experiments are reported in which dog red cells were first loaded with supranormal quantities of Na and water and then reinjected into the dog. Over the course of 26–40 h the Na- and water-loaded cells returned to a normal state of hydration as judged by their density. It is concluded that dog red cells possess some means of correcting their swollen status in vivo, despite their lack of a ouabain-sensitive cation transport apparatus.
